1. Explore Affordable Extension Options Not all extensions come with a hefty price tag. Synthetic hair extensions are a more affordable alternative to human hair, offering similar versatility for styling. While synthetic options may not last as long, they are perfect for occasional use or trying out new looks. Clip-in extensions are another budget-friendly choice, allowing you to enhance your hairstyle without committing to a professional application process. For those who prefer human hair, consider “remy hair” blends, which balance quality and affordability. You can also look for brands offering discounts, seasonal sales, or bulk purchasing options to save on costs. 2. DIY Extensions for Cost Savings Skip the salon fees by learning how to install and style extensions yourself. Clip-ins and halo extensions are particularly user-friendly and require no professional tools or skills. Online tutorials, courses, or workshops can guide you in mastering simple techniques for applying and maintaining extensions at home. DIY extensions can be tailored to achieve a natural appearance. Be sure to invest in quality tools like wide-tooth combs and heat protectants to keep your extensions looking flawless while protecting them from unnecessary wear and tear. 3. Shop Smart for Quality at a Bargain Thrifty shopping doesn’t mean sacrificing quality. Search online marketplaces, beauty supply stores, or factory outlet shops for discounts on high-quality extensions. Look for reviews, certifications, and return policies to ensure you’re getting a good deal. Additionally, join beauty forums or local hairstyling groups where members often sell lightly used or unopened extensions at a fraction of the cost. 4. Maintain Extensions to Maximize Longevity Proper care is essential for extending the life of your extensions, especially if you’re working within a budget. Use sulfate-free shampoos, detangle regularly, and store clip-ins properly when not in use. By treating your extensions with care, you’ll avoid frequent replacements and save money in the long run. 5. Combine Extensions with Styling Hacks You don’t always need a full head of extensions to achieve a stunning look. Strategic placement, such as adding volume at the crown or length at the sides, can create a dramatic transformation with fewer pieces. Pair extensions with braids, buns, or ponytails to blend them seamlessly with your natural hair and make a small investment go further. 6. Watch for Professional Deals and Packages Bundle deals are a great option for those looking for a variety of hair extension styles but don't want to spend a lot of money. Many salons offer special promotions, package deals, or discounts for new clients. Keep an eye on local beauty shops or social media pages for offers on hair extension services. Additionally, beauty schools often provide services at reduced rates since students are gaining hands-on experience under professional supervision. Understanding Hair Extensions and Their Effects Hair extensions, when applied correctly and maintained properly, are generally safe for natural hair. However, improper use or neglect can lead to damage. Here’s a breakdown of the factors that matter most: Application Method and Quality of Hair Extensions A common misconception is that all hair extensions inherently damage your natural hair. In reality, the application method and the quality of the extensions play crucial roles in determining their impact. Professional techniques such as tape-ins, clip-ins, and sew-ins, when performed by an experienced stylist, can distribute weight evenly and minimize stress on your scalp. However, improperly installed extensions or overly tight braiding can lead to tension and hair loss, a condition known as traction alopecia. Additionally, not all extensions are created equal. High-quality, human hair extensions that match your natural hair’s texture and weight are less likely to cause damage. On the other hand, synthetic extensions, while often more affordable, can tangle easily and exert more pull on your natural strands, increasing the risk of breakage and discomfort. Maintenance Practices for Healthy Extensions and Natural Hair Another myth surrounding hair extensions is that they are a set-it-and-forget-it solution. Proper maintenance is essential to ensure both the longevity of the extensions and the health of your natural hair. Neglecting regular care can result in product buildup, breakage, and scalp irritation. It’s important to keep your scalp clean, gently detangle your extensions daily with a wide-tooth comb, and follow a consistent care routine. Using sulfate-free shampoos and avoiding harsh chemicals can also help maintain the integrity of both the extensions and your natural hair. By investing time in proper maintenance, you can enjoy the benefits of hair extensions without compromising the health and vitality of your natural locks. Remember, proper care and attention are the keys to keeping your extensions in top condition. How to Avoid Hair Damage with Extensions 1. Choose the Right Professional Invest in a licensed and experienced stylist to ensure safe application and removal. 2. Follow a Maintenance Routine Use sulfate-free shampoos, avoid harsh chemicals, and detangle your extensions daily with a wide-tooth comb. 3.Limit Wear Time Don’t keep extensions in for longer than recommended—typically six to eight weeks. African Cultures: The Roots of Hair Extensions In many African cultures, hair extensions have long been a part of traditional styling, tracing back centuries. Using natural fibers, beads, and sometimes human hair, African tribes created intricate braids and extensions to signify age, tribe, and marital status. Today, this heritage lives on, with braided extensions and protective hairstyles celebrated and embraced globally as part of African identity and beauty. Asia: Hair as an Expression of Elegance In several Asian cultures, hairstyles and hair adornments are deeply rooted in tradition and symbolism, hair has been a symbol of femininity, elegance, and social status. Countries like China and Japan have traditions of long, flowing hair that are often celebrated in art and history. In recent years, the rise of sleek, natural-looking hair extensions allows people to embrace this timeless aesthetic with added volume and length, aligning with cultural values of grace and beauty. The Middle East: Luxury and Tradition The Middle Eastern region has a history of celebrating beauty and luxury, with hair extensions playing a role in achieving the full, voluminous hairstyles often associated with traditional beauty standards. From ancient times, Middle Eastern women have used extensions to add volume to their hair, emphasizing beauty ideals that are deeply ingrained in their culture. Today, hair extensions continue to be popular, enabling women to achieve iconic, voluminous looks that highlight their cultural roots. The Americas: Extensions as a Cultural Fusion In North and South America, hair extensions have been influenced by various cultural groups and traditions. Indigenous cultures have long valued hair as a symbol of strength and spirituality, while Afro-Caribbean influences bring in braiding and natural extensions. The popularity of hair extensions has continued to grow in modern-day America, celebrating diversity in style and identity and allowing individuals to experiment with different looks. Europe: From Royalty to Runways In Europe, hair extensions have evolved from symbolizing wealth and status to becoming a mainstream beauty accessory. Historically, European royals would wear elaborate wigs and extensions to show power and prestige. Today, hair extensions are widely used in fashion and everyday life, enhancing natural beauty and allowing for a variety of creative styles. 1. Daily and Deep Cleaning Protocols Regular cleaning should be a cornerstone of your salon operations. This includes daily disinfecting of high-touch areas like chairs, counters, and tools between clients. Items that come in touch with clients should be cleaned and disinfected after each session. Also, implement weekly deep-cleaning protocols, focusing on floors, upholstery, and less visible areas. Use EPA-registered disinfectants known to kill a broad range of bacteria and viruses. 2. Sanitizing Tools and Equipment It is really important that any equipment is thoroughly cleaned between usage. Tools like brushes, combs, scissors, and styling tools are used continuously throughout the day and need consistent sanitization. After each use, these tools should be soaked in disinfectant solutions. 3. Hand Hygiene for All Encourage a routine where every stylist and client washes their hands upon entering the salon. Providing accessible hand sanitizer stations at multiple locations. 4. Ventilation Matters Proper ventilation reduces the accumulation of potentially harmful chemicals and dust. Ensure that your salon has a reliable ventilation system and consider opening windows where possible to maintain fresh airflow. 5. Disinfecting Chairs and Stations Between Clients Client chairs and styling stations are high-contact areas and should be sanitized after every client. 6. Healthy Product Choices Whenever possible, use eco-friendly, hypoallergenic, and low-chemical products. These are gentler on both clients and stylists, reducing the risk of allergic reactions and minimizing exposure to potentially harsh chemicals. Final Thoughts!
